PROBLEM TO BE SOLVED: To provide a torque limiter of easy maintenance, and simple constitution, that is compact and economical, capable of securely stably conducting torque transmission, reducing oppression force of a torque transmitting ball by a spring when torque transmission is disconnected by overload for restricting abrasion and improving durability, and reducing the number of replacement for abraded parts. SOLUTION: An overload protective mechanism is provided with a lock recess 1 for an input side rotary body A, a pocket hole 7 for an output side rotary body B, the torque transmitting ball 12, a plurality of small abutment balls 11, a cone plate 10, and the spring 9. In a torque transmission state, the small abutment balls 11 get in contact with the inner circumferential side of an inclination surface 10a of the cone plate 10. In a non-torque transmission state, the small abutment balls 11 get in contact with the outer circumferential side of the inclination surface 10a. When the torque transmission state is changed into the non-torque transmission state, the small abutment balls 11 get abutted on the torque transmitting ball 12 at such positions that they get further apart from a center line of the pocket hole 7.
